Per 100g Comparison

NutrientLobsterTilapia
Calories8996
Protein19g20.1g
Carbs0g0g
Fat0.9g1.7g
Fiber0g0g
Sugar0g0g
Sodium486mg52mg
Cholesterol146mg50mg
Saturated Fat0.21g0.59g
Potassium230mg302mg
Vitamin A1mcg0mcg
Vitamin C0mg0mg
Calcium96mg10mg
Iron0.29mg0.56mg
